Product Details
This limited edition 6-coin Gold proof set honors the symbol of Britannia with a striking design by Emily Damstra. Featuring her connection to the sea, it comes in themed packaging with a booklet on Britannia’s history.

Set Highlights:
  • Limited edition presentation of 100 sets.
  • Contains a total of 1.925 oz of .999 gold.
  • Includes the following sizes: 1 oz, 1/2 oz, 1/4 oz, 1/10 oz, 1/20 oz and 1/40 oz.
  • Comes in the original mint box with a certificate of authenticity.
  • Obverse: Each coin features the effigy of His Majesty King Charles III and the monetary denomination, designed by Martin Jennings.
  • Reverse: Depicts a unique design of Britannia by Emily Damstra, exploring Britannia's connection to the sea. She stands boldly with her staff and shield over the ocean.
  • Sovereign coins backed by the British government.

The Royal Mint Britannia
Britannia is the female personification of Britain, an enduring symbol that has appeared on coinage for centuries. Throughout shifts in art and politics, technology and popular culture, she has reflected the spirit and values of the nation. This release marks 350 years since this iconic figure first was used on circulating coins.
